SUMMARY:
UltraBac supports several types of storage devices. These are displayed by selecting "Select"/"Storage Device." Select which type of storage device to list by clicking on the down arrow next to the "Show" list box. The types of storage devices include Tape, Disk, Device Set, Image and Partition.
DETAILS:

Figure 1: Select Device
The active storage device is displayed on the Title line of the UltraBac Main Window. This is the storage device used when performing an Ad-hoc (Perform Backup) backup. The default storage device becomes the active tape device when UltraBac is invoked and is the storage device used when creating a scheduled backup group unless another storage device is specified.
To change the active storage device without making it the default storage device, highlight the storage device and select "OK." This change will be reflected on the Title line of the UltraBac Main Window. To change both the active and default storage devices, highlight the storage device, select "Save as Default Device" option and then select "OK."
Use the slider to view columns not displayed. The "Select Storage Device:" list box displays the "Device", "Identifier", and "Path" columns. The "Device" column lists the members of the device category displayed in the "Show" list box. Windows NT/2000 assigns the "Identifiers" for tape devices, while the user assigns the identifier for disks and images during their creation. The "Path" applies to disk paths defined as storage devices.
The "Save as Default Device" option causes the selected storage device to become the default device in addition to the current device.

If you click on the "Edit" button when selecting a tape device on this screen, it brings you to the "Drive Cleaning Values" screen. If you have an autoloader and are using our Medium Changer device driver, this allows you to set the cleaning interval on your drive, so that every certain number of hours the drive will automatically do a cleaning procedure.
